What Was Paper Made Out Of. Paper, matted or felted sheet, usually of cellulose fibers, formed on a wire screen from water suspension. Today almost all paper is made using industrial machinery, while handmade paper survives as a specialized craft and a medium for artistic. Papermaking, formation of a matted or felted sheet, usually of cellulose fibres, from water suspension on a wire screen. Although wood has become the major source of fiber for. In 1719, a french biologist, rene antoine ferchault de reaumur, wrote a scientific paper pointing out that wasps could make paper nests by chewing wood, so why couldn't humans?
